3.Place your printer on a firm, solid surface. If you put it on an unsteady surface, it might fall and become damaged. If you place the printer on a soft surface, such as a rug, sofa, or bed, the vents may be blocked, causing it to overheat
10.You must only use the 3-conductor,18 AWG, SVT type, IEC320 style power cord provided with your printer e.g., a plug having a third grounding pin. This plug will only fit into a grounding-typepower outlet. This is a safety feature. To avoid the risk of electric shock, contact your electrician to replace the receptacle if you are unable to insert the plug into the outlet. Never use a ground adapter plug to connect the printer to a power source receptacle that lacks a ground connection terminal
